Seite 2 von 3
Verfasst: 27.07.2006 19:47
von paintball-Mekka
so und nochmal für alle.....
backup mit mysqldump
und dann der fehler.
Fehler bei der Anfrage:
CREATE TABLE phpbb_sessions( session_id char(32) NOT NULL, session_user_id mediumint(8) NOT NULL, session_start int(11) NOT NULL, session_time int(11) NOT NULL, session_ip char(8) NOT NULL, session_page int(11) NOT NULL, session_logged_in tinyint(1) NOT NULL, PRIMARY KEY (session_id), KEY session_user_id (session_user_id), KEY session_id_ip_user_id (session_id, session_ip, session_user_id);
MySQL meldet:
Couldn't create table: phpbb_sessions
Verfasst: 27.07.2006 20:04
von Mahony
Hallo
Lass mal den
Database Maintenance Mod drüberlaufen und versuche das Backup dann nochmal zu machen.
Edit: Du hast das Backup ganz sicher nicht mit dem Mysqldumper gemacht - richtig?
Das Backup über die Foreneigene Backup-Funktion verursacht Fehler.
Also in Zukunft deine Backups mit einem anderen Tool machen. (z.b. Mysqldumper)
So und jetzt zu deinem Fehler: Ich habe mir die Backup-Datei angesehen und da fehlt die schliessende Klammer
Der betreffende Teil muss so aussehen:
Code: Alles auswählen
DROP TABLE IF EXISTS phpbb_sessions;
CREATE TABLE phpbb_sessions(
session_id char(32) NOT NULL,
session_user_id mediumint(8) NOT NULL,
session_start int(11) NOT NULL,
session_time int(11) NOT NULL,
session_ip char(8) NOT NULL,
session_page int(11) NOT NULL,
session_logged_in tinyint(1) NOT NULL,
PRIMARY KEY (session_id),
KEY session_user_id (session_user_id),
KEY session_id_ip_user_id (session_id, session_ip, session_user_id)
);
Die letzte Klammer fehlt in deinem Backup (Also das hier
);
Bei dir sieht der letzte Teil so aus (hier habe ich nur das Ende, also den wichtigen Teil, gepostet - damit du verstehst was gemeint ist):
Code: Alles auswählen
KEY session_id_ip_user_id (session_id, session_ip, session_user_id);
Grüße: Mahony
Verfasst: 27.07.2006 21:12
von paintball-Mekka
http://www.phpbb.de/viewtopic.php?t=126 ... ateroutine
check den mal....
das mit der Klammer hab ich auch grad mitbekommen.
Also lag ich schon mal nicht davon weit weg....
jetzt isset warscheinlich noch die updateroutine.
kann ich da besser nicht die alte version installierenund dann nen neues backup machen oder is ist das einfach
Verfasst: 27.07.2006 21:47
von paintball-Mekka
phpBB : Kritischer Fehler
Error creating new session
DEBUG MODE
SQL Error : 1054 Unknown column 'session_admin' in 'field list'
INSERT INTO phpbb_sessions (session_id, session_user_id, session_start, session_time, session_ip, session_page, session_logged_in, session_admin) VALUES ('10d3715f1e57139d3d1b5e025a42e38e', -1, 1154029489, 1154029489, '508cf25f', -1, 0, 0)
Line : 187
File : sessions.php
ich denke das das backup noch von der alten version ist. 2.0.13
und daher kann ich nix machen
wund was muss ich jetzt tun um das hinzubiegen?
Verfasst: 27.07.2006 22:00
von Mahony
Hallo
Wenn du dein Forum updaten willst, schaue dir das hier mal an--->
http://www.phpbb.de/doku/phpbb-update.php
Edit: Du musst den Ordner install hochladen und dann die update_to_latest.php im Browser aufrufen. Also
http://deinedomain.de/phpBB/install/upd ... latest.php wobei du diesen Teil
http://deinedomain.de/phpBB natürlich anpassen musst.
Grüße: Mahony
Verfasst: 27.07.2006 22:08
von paintball-Mekka
ohhh mann......
das backup ist von 2.0.13
und das forum ist aktuell....
Könnte aber auch nen mod sein der das verursacht oder?
Verfasst: 27.07.2006 22:13
von Mahony
Hallo
ohhh mann......
das backup ist von 2.0.13
und das forum ist aktuell....
Das beste wäre, das Forum per update_to_latest.php upzudaten und dann die MODs (falls du welche hattest) wieder einzubauen.
Grüße: Mahony
Verfasst: 27.07.2006 22:15
von paintball-Mekka
hab jetzt das original phpbb 2..021 drauf ohne veränderungen und der fehler bleibt...
also der hat keine admin tabelle und die wird nicht angelegt...
mahoni was für n codo muss denn da noch rein?
Verfasst: 27.07.2006 22:23
von paintball-Mekka
die tabellen im sql sind von
sessions
sessions keys alle leer
Verfasst: 27.07.2006 22:25
von Mahony
Hallo
Hast du die /install/update_to_latest.php im Browser aufgerufen?
Was genau hast du gemacht? Nur die Dateien hochgeladen?
Grüße: Mahony